数据结构

1.在一个单链表中,若要在p所指向的结点之前插入一个新结点,则此算法的时间复杂度为()AO(n)BO(n/2)CO(1)DO(根号下n)2.所说的表头指针到底是什么数据类... 1.在一个单链表中,若要在p所指向的结点之前插入一个新结点,则此算法的时间复杂度为()AO(n)BO(n/2)CO(1)DO(根号下n)
2.所说的表头指针到底是什么数据类型 是指针还是结构体 经常会看到这样的说法 指针p所指向的结点,这里的指针p到底是什么数据类型 是结构体吗 如果是结构体那让p=head怎样理解
3 在双向指针中会有这样的说法 p所指向的结点 这里的p跟他的前一个结点的后驱指针是不是一样呢
4。在双向链表中,p->pior->next 到底指向什么
各位大侠帮忙解释一下 越详细越好 好的我可以追加分 我自学数据结构学来学去学了个稀里糊涂 希望高手指点一下 谢谢啦
展开
 我来答
chiconysun
2011-03-06 · TA获得超过2.2万个赞
知道大有可为答主
回答量:5410
采纳率:92%
帮助的人:2534万
展开全部
1、A,因为需要找到该点的前驱,链表为顺序访问,时间复杂度为O(n)
2、表头指针为结构体指针,p指向的结点指p指向的目标,同样的,p=head就是指针p也指向表头结点了
3、p所指向的结点是结构体,但是p存放的是该结构体的地址,同样地,该结构体中的一个数据域存放着其前驱或者后继的地址,这个地址当然就是指针了
4、p->prior->next就是该结点的前驱的后继,就是自己,打个比方说,独生子女的双亲的孩子是谁?肯定就是自己了
acehb70
2011-03-06 · TA获得超过638个赞
知道小有建树答主
回答量:747
采纳率:0%
帮助的人:168万
展开全部
社 严蔚敏主编的。
还想学深的话 就学《算法设计与分析》 也是清华大学出版的 王晓东主编。这两本如果你够能掌握,你就不是一般水平了。
之所以推荐清华的是因为清华大学出版社在其网站上提供电子课件免费下载,配合教材效果会好很多,清华教授的水平就不用说了。
如果有时间建议你学数据结构前先把《离散数学》学一下。其实数据结构之是要求要先学完《离散数学》和《概率论》的。
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
群裙去
2011-03-08
知道答主
回答量:3
采纳率:0%
帮助的人:0
展开全部
A
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
wangmoajiao
2011-03-09
知道答主
回答量:1
采纳率:0%
帮助的人:0
展开全部
1.A
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
收起 更多回答(2)
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式